Just returned from watching youth team playing in the cup vs Rochdale, very entertaining game in which they won 2...1, Rovers scored first, they equalized late on, and Rovers then went onto win it in injury time. Some promising youngsters on view, did notice a few scouts from other clubs having a good look.

To be honest nobody was head and shoulders above anybody else, Don't actually know names as such,, recognized Lewis Scattergood and Cody Prior from the other night, both were sub's who did OK, Scatts should have scored twice, but he will know that himself, the boy I need to take another look at came on as a sub, lad called Omar, only just back after a long injury, looked very lively, good technique and very aware. Paul Stanicliffe doing a good job with them.
